hi,

i have a problem with wawelan pci-pcmcia converter under NetBSD 1.6.

this is a Lucent Tech. 015219 Rev.A (Model: PCIPC)

im compiled pcmcia and pcic into kernel, and at boot:

wi0 at pcmcia0 function 0: Lucent Technologies, WaveLAN/IEEE, Version 01.01
wi0:wi0: init failed
could not get mac address, attach failed
wi0: failed to attach controller

and of course i cant uset the wi0.

im plug a pcmcia modem into converter and its works:

wi0 detached
com3 at pcmcia0 function 0: serial device
com3: ns16550a, working fifo


from kernel conf:

# PCMCIA bus support
pcmcia* at pcic? controller ? socket ?
pcmcia* at tcic? controller ? socket ?

# PCI PCMCIA controllers
#pcic0  at pci? dev? function ?
pcic*   at pci? dev? function ?

wi*     at pcmcia? function ?           # Lucent WaveLan IEEE (802.11)

anybody use same card under NetBSD ?

(this hw-config works fine with Free/OpenBSD)
